// 주문완료 버튼을 누를 시 실행 tableId 와 주문한 메뉴를 args로 만들고 메인화면으로 보냄 private void ordered_btn_Click(object sender, RoutedEventArgs e) { OrderEventArgs args = new OrderEventArgs(); args = getOrederEventArgs(false); orderedMenuList.Clear(); selectedFood.Items.Refresh(); OnGoBackMainWindow?.Invoke(this, args); }
//결제버튼 private void payMent_btn_Click(object sender, RoutedEventArgs e) { OrderEventArgs args = new OrderEventArgs(); args = getOrederEventArgs(true); orderedMenuList.Clear(); //아직은 현금과 카드에서 다른점이 없다 if (paymentType.ToString() == "CASH") { OnGoBackMainWindow?.Invoke(this, args); } else if (paymentType.ToString() == "CREDIT") { OnGoBackMainWindow?.Invoke(this, args); } }
private void goBackMainWindow() { OnGoBackMainWindow?.Invoke(this, null); }
private void GoBackButton_Click(object sender, RoutedEventArgs e) { OnGoBackMainWindow?.Invoke(this, null); }
//돌아가기 버튼을 누를 시 실행 private void GoBackBtn_Click(object sender, RoutedEventArgs e) { orderedMenuList.Clear(); OnGoBackMainWindow?.Invoke(this, null); }